Freedom of movement takes on a new meaning

Omnidirectional marker technology is based on a new concept: combining high accuracy with large-viewing angle capability, enhancing freedom of movement for the users during tracking.
It supports arbitrary 3D marker shapes and sizes, but typical implementations are prisms, cylinders, cones or spheres, whose surface is populated with a geometry of fiducials optimized by Atracsys to ensure accurate and smooth marker detectability, with a viewing angle that can be up to 360° rotation.

Forpi pointer

forpi pointer

Available off-the-shelf

This generic marker is designed to help customers quickly evaluate the omnidirectional marker concept. Available off-the-shelf, it features a rigid 3D-printed body equipped with retro-reflective discs for reliable tracking performance.
The tip is a precise ruby sphere and ensures accurate spatial referencing, making it ideal for evaluation and prototyping.

Custom forpi markers

Fitting your application needs

forpi is truly meant for customization. Based on the requirements of your application, Atracsys creates the forpi geometry that will suit your needs adequately.
Arbitrary shape and size are supported, allowing you to exploit the full potential of this technology and of complex geometry tracking.
